Distance from Washington to Simi Valley by Car and Plane

The flight distance from Washington (DC) to Simi Valley (CA) is 2319 miles or 3732 kilometers or 2014 nautical miles.
Driving distance from Washington to Simi Valley is 2691 miles (4331 kilometers).
Difference between fly and travel by a car is 372 miles or 599 km.
